NUGGETS
Offense via @Brogan.Slaughter


Day 6 of practice provided us with some rainy/windy weather you’d expect to see in fall football and seemed to limit the versatility of the offensive play calling. We saw this through some repeated low snaps, particularly to Gabarri Johnson. The first and second team offense seemed to value keeping the ball on the ground and getting the ball to playmakers in short-yardage situations, showcasing their speed and versatility in the open field.

Running backs Salahadin Allah and Cornell Hatcher highlighted the group today, the latter with the lone touchdown of the scrimmage. The touchdown came from a simple zone trap scheme from about five yards out where Hatcher spun off one defender, diving into the endzone for six.
